Job Description

The Maintenance Technician is responsible for the upkeep and maintenance of apartment homes, buildings, and grounds, and performs highly diversified duties to include but not limited to: repairing flooring, drywall, and appliances; troubleshooting and repairing plumbing, electrical, safety and security systems (lighting, locks, smoke/CO2 alarms, etc.), and HVAC systems; painting (interior and exterior); and cleaning (sweeping, mopping, garden/yard upkeep, etc.). The Maintenance Technician is responsible for conducting all job duties in accordance with company policy and all safety protocols, and supports the overall objective of meeting the expectations of the Client, based on the respective operating capital budget and management agreement.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BLITITES

1.Client Relations

  • Carry out the philosophies and wishes of the Owner in the daily overall operations of the apartment community to ensure FPI is meeting the Client objective and expectations

2.General Maintenance Overview

  • Adhere to the assigned maintenance program to ensure the most economical, proper and safe condition of the property
  • Follow the preventative maintenance program as outlined in the Maintenance Manual.
  • Ensure grounds, curbs, and property aesthetics are in compliance with the FPI Curb Appeal Policies.
  • Assist with required periodic inspections as outlined in the Safety and Maintenance Manuals or as specified by Client or Lender.

3.On-call/After Hours Response

  • Serve as on-call maintenance providing evening, weekends and holiday emergency services, as outlined in the Employee Handbook and Maintenance Manual

4.Unit Turnover

  • Perform maintenance inspections and repairs on vacant apartments to ensure proper operating conditions and appearance upon move-in.
  • Coordinate and/or assist in painting vacant apartments.
  • Change out appliances-install and remove as necessary.
  • Ensure timely completion of all unit turnovers according to FPI guidelines or based on the established scope of work for the property location.

5. General Maintenance Equipment and Systems

  • Repair and maintain any equipment owned by the apartment community including proper storage in a secure Location Maintain all maintenance shops and storage rooms in an orderly fashion and in compliance with safety regulations
  • Properly secure all parts, supplies, and property equipment
  • Maintain, within the budgetary limits, an inventory of parts to make necessary repairs

Qualifications

Minimum Requirements:

  • Minimum 1 year of experience in a similar role, preferably within Residential Property Management. Experience in hotel maintenance, facilities maintenance, or construction will also be considered.
  • High School diploma or equivalency certificate required; technical school and/or CAMT certification, preferred.
  • Valid Driver's License, a good driving record, current motor vehicle insurance which meets State requirements, and an operable vehicle that meets FPI's Driving Standards and Personal Vehicle Use policy.
  • Must be able to wear a respirator, and have the ability to be medically fit for duty and cleared to wear a respirator, and comply with FPI's facial hair policy.
  • Must be proficient in speaking, reading, and writing in English.
  • Basic computer skills (email, internet, etc.).
  • May be required to provide and maintain own tools.
